Turkey and Bell Pepper Panini

Prep Time: 10 mins
Cook Time: 15 mins
Total Time: 25 mins
Cuisine: Italian
Serves: 2 servings

Ingredients

  1. 4 slices of bread
  2. 1 cup sliced turkey
  3. 1 bell pepper, sliced
  4. 2 slices of cheese
  5. 1 tablespoon pesto
  6. Butter for grilling

Instructions

  1. Begin by gathering all your ingredients: 4 slices of your preferred bread, 1 cup of sliced turkey, 1 bell pepper (sliced), 2 slices of cheese (such as provolone or mozzarella), 1 tablespoon of pesto, and butter for grilling.
  2. Heat a skillet or panini press over medium heat while you prepare your sandwich.
  3. Spread a thin layer of butter on one side of each slice of bread. This will help achieve a golden, crispy crust when grilling.
  4. On the unbuttered side of two slices of bread, spread 1 tablespoon of pesto evenly. This will add flavor and moisture to your panini.
  5. Layer the sliced turkey evenly over the pesto on both slices of bread.
  6. Add the sliced bell pepper on top of the turkey. You can use any color of bell pepper, such as red, yellow, or green, for added flavor and visual appeal.
  7. Place a slice of cheese on top of the bell pepper. If you prefer extra cheesy panini, feel free to add another slice of cheese.
  8. Top the sandwich with the remaining two slices of bread, ensuring the buttered side is facing out.
  9. Carefully place the sandwich in the heated skillet or panini press. If using a skillet, press down gently with a spatula to ensure even grilling.
  10. Cook for about 3-5 minutes on each side, or until the bread is golden brown and crispy, and the cheese has melted. If using a panini press, follow the manufacturer's instructions for cooking time.
  11. Once cooked, remove the panini from the heat and let it rest for a minute before slicing. This will help the cheese set slightly.
  12. Cut the panini in half and serve immediately. You can pair it with a side salad or chips for a complete meal.

Tips

  1. Bread Selection Matters: Choose a sturdy bread like ciabatta or sourdough that can withstand grilling without falling apart.
  2. Butter Technique: Spread butter evenly and thinly on the outside of the bread for that perfect golden-brown crispiness.
  3. Cheese Melting Hack: Let your cheese come to room temperature before grilling to ensure it melts more smoothly and evenly.
  4. Press with Purpose: If using a skillet, use a heavy pan or press to create those classic panini grill marks and compress the sandwich.
  5. Don't Rush the Cooking: Medium heat is key - too high, and you'll burn the bread before the cheese melts; too low, and you'll end up with a soggy sandwich.
  6. Pesto Pro Tip: For an extra flavor boost, try different pesto variations like sun-dried tomato or spinach pesto.
  7. Serving Suggestion: Slice the panini diagonally for that Instagram-worthy presentation and easier eating.
